CONTRACT AWARDS

The Boeing Company, Seattle, Wash., is being awarded a $661,802,071 cost-plus-fixed-fee contract for the Joint Strike Fighter Concept Demonstration Program which will feature flying aircraft demonstrators, ground and flight technology demonstrations, and continued refinement of the contractor's weapons system concept for the next generation strike fighter for the Navy, Marine Corps, Air Force and Royal Navy. Work will be performed in Seattle, Wash., and is expected to be completed by February 2001. Contract funds would not have expired at the end of the current fiscal year. This contract was competitively procured by a request for proposal and four offers were received. The Naval Air Systems Command, Arlington, Va., is the contracting activity (N00019-97-C-0037).

Lockheed Martin Corporation, Bethesda, Md., is being awarded a $718,800,000 cost-plus-fixed-fee contract for the Joint Strike Fighter Concept Demonstration Program which will feature flying aircraft demonstrators, ground and flight technology demonstrations, and continued refinement of the contractor's weapon system concept for the next generation strike fighter for the Navy, Marine Corps, Air Force and Royal Navy. Work will be performed in Palm Dale, Calif. (71 percent), and Fort Worth, Texas (29 percent), and is expected to be completed by February 2001. Contract funds would not have expired at the end of the current fiscal year. This contract was competitively procured by a request for proposal and four offers were received. The Naval Air Systems Command, Arlington, Va., is the contracting activity (N00019-97-C-0038).
